static GtkWidget *
glade_eprop_accel_view (GladeEditorProperty * eprop)
{
  GladeEPropAccel *eprop_accel = GLADE_EPROP_ACCEL (eprop);
  GtkWidget *view_widget;
  GtkCellRenderer *renderer;
  GtkTreeViewColumn *column;

  eprop_accel->model = (GtkTreeModel *) 
    gtk_tree_store_new (ACCEL_NUM_COLUMNS, G_TYPE_STRING,   /* The GSignal name formatted for display */
			G_TYPE_STRING,      /* The GSignal name */
			G_TYPE_STRING,      /* The text to show in the accelerator cell */
			G_TYPE_INT, /* PangoWeight attribute for bold headers */
			G_TYPE_INT, /* PangoStyle attribute for italic grey unset items */
			G_TYPE_STRING,      /* Foreground colour for italic grey unset items */
			G_TYPE_BOOLEAN,     /* Visible attribute to hide items for header entries */
			G_TYPE_BOOLEAN,     /* Whether the key has been entered for this row */
			G_TYPE_UINT,        /* Hardware keycode */
			G_TYPE_INT);        /* GdkModifierType */
  
  view_widget = gtk_tree_view_new_with_model (eprop_accel->model);
  gtk_tree_view_set_show_expanders (GTK_TREE_VIEW (view_widget), FALSE);
  gtk_tree_view_set_enable_search (GTK_TREE_VIEW (view_widget), FALSE);

  /********************* signal name column *********************/
  renderer = gtk_cell_renderer_text_new ();
  g_object_set (G_OBJECT (renderer), "editable", FALSE, NULL);

  column = gtk_tree_view_column_new_with_attributes
      (_("Signal"), renderer,
       "text", ACCEL_COLUMN_SIGNAL, "weight", ACCEL_COLUMN_WEIGHT, NULL);


  gtk_tree_view_column_set_expand (GTK_TREE_VIEW_COLUMN (column), TRUE);
  gtk_tree_view_append_column (GTK_TREE_VIEW (view_widget), column);

  /********************* accel editor column *********************/
  renderer = gtk_cell_renderer_accel_new ();
  g_object_set (G_OBJECT (renderer), "editable", TRUE, NULL);

  g_signal_connect (renderer, "accel-edited", G_CALLBACK (accel_edited), eprop);
  g_signal_connect (renderer, "accel-cleared",
                    G_CALLBACK (accel_cleared), eprop);

  column = gtk_tree_view_column_new_with_attributes
      (_("Accelerator Key"), renderer,
       "text", ACCEL_COLUMN_TEXT,
       "foreground", ACCEL_COLUMN_FOREGROUND,
       "style", ACCEL_COLUMN_STYLE, "visible", ACCEL_COLUMN_VISIBLE, NULL);

  gtk_tree_view_column_set_expand (GTK_TREE_VIEW_COLUMN (column), TRUE);
  gtk_tree_view_append_column (GTK_TREE_VIEW (view_widget), column);

  return view_widget;
}

GtkWidget* create_hotkey_editor(void)
{
	GtkWidget *hotkey_tree_view = NULL;
	GtkCellRenderer *renderer = NULL;
	GtkListStore  *model = NULL;
	GtkTreeViewColumn *column = NULL;
	GtkTreeIter iter = {0};

	/* create a tree view */
	hotkey_tree_view = gtk_tree_view_new();
	gtk_tree_view_set_headers_visible(GTK_TREE_VIEW(hotkey_tree_view), FALSE);
	g_signal_connect (hotkey_tree_view, "button-press-event", G_CALLBACK (start_editing_cb), NULL);
	g_signal_connect (hotkey_tree_view, "row-activated", G_CALLBACK (start_editing_keybd_cb), NULL);
	g_object_set(hotkey_tree_view, "visible", TRUE, NULL);

	/* create the Egg Cell Renderer and connect to signals */
	renderer = (GtkCellRenderer*) gtk_cell_renderer_accel_new ();
	g_object_set(renderer, "editable", TRUE, NULL);
	g_signal_connect (renderer, "accel-edited", G_CALLBACK (accel_edited_callback), hotkey_tree_view);
	g_signal_connect (renderer, "accel-cleared", G_CALLBACK (accel_cleared_callback), hotkey_tree_view);

	/* create a column and set the created renderer - append the same to the tree view */
	column = gtk_tree_view_column_new_with_attributes ("Shortcut", renderer, NULL);
	/* since it's a custom renderer, setting the data to the cell needs to be custom as well */
	gtk_tree_view_column_set_cell_data_func (column, renderer, accel_set_func, NULL, NULL);
	gtk_tree_view_append_column (GTK_TREE_VIEW(hotkey_tree_view), column);

	/* create the list store for the tree */
	model = gtk_list_store_new (1, G_TYPE_POINTER);
	gtk_tree_view_set_model (GTK_TREE_VIEW (hotkey_tree_view), GTK_TREE_MODEL(model));

	gtk_list_store_append (model, &iter);
	gtk_list_store_set (model, &iter, HOTKEY_COLUMN, &app_hotkey, -1);

	/* The tree view has acquired its own reference to the
	*  model, so we can drop ours. That way the model will
	*  be freed automatically when the tree view is destroyed */
	g_object_unref (model);

	g_object_set(hotkey_tree_view, "visible", TRUE, NULL);

	return hotkey_tree_view;
}

static GObject *
games_controls_list_constructor (GType type,
                                 guint n_construct_properties,
                                 GObjectConstructParam *construct_params)
{
  GObject *object;
  GamesControlsList *list;
  GtkScrolledWindow *scrolled_window;
  GtkTreeViewColumn *column;
  GtkCellRenderer *label_renderer, *key_renderer;
  GtkListStore *store;

  object = G_OBJECT_CLASS (games_controls_list_parent_class)->constructor
             (type, n_construct_properties, construct_params);

  list = GAMES_CONTROLS_LIST (object);
  scrolled_window = GTK_SCROLLED_WINDOW (object);

  store = gtk_list_store_new (N_COLUMNS,
                              G_TYPE_STRING,
                              G_TYPE_STRING,
                              G_TYPE_UINT,
                              G_TYPE_UINT,
                              G_TYPE_UINT,
                              G_TYPE_UINT);
  list->priv->store = store;
  list->priv->model = GTK_TREE_MODEL (store);

  list->priv->view = gtk_tree_view_new_with_model (list->priv->model);
  g_object_unref (store);

  gtk_tree_view_set_headers_visible (GTK_TREE_VIEW (list->priv->view), FALSE);
  gtk_tree_view_set_enable_search (GTK_TREE_VIEW (list->priv->view), FALSE);

  /* label column */
  label_renderer = gtk_cell_renderer_text_new ();
  column = gtk_tree_view_column_new_with_attributes ("Control",
						     label_renderer,
						     "text", LABEL_COLUMN,
						     NULL);
  gtk_tree_view_append_column (GTK_TREE_VIEW (list->priv->view), column);

  /* key column */
  key_renderer = gtk_cell_renderer_accel_new ();
  g_object_set (key_renderer,
                "editable", TRUE,
                "accel-mode", GTK_CELL_RENDERER_ACCEL_MODE_OTHER,
                NULL);
  g_signal_connect (key_renderer, "accel-edited",
                    G_CALLBACK (accel_edited_cb), list);
  g_signal_connect (key_renderer, "accel-cleared",
                    G_CALLBACK (accel_cleared_cb), list);

  column = gtk_tree_view_column_new_with_attributes ("Key",
						     key_renderer,
                                                     "accel-key", KEYCODE_COLUMN,
                                                     "accel-mods", KEYMODS_COLUMN,
						     NULL);
  gtk_tree_view_append_column (GTK_TREE_VIEW (list->priv->view), column);

  gtk_container_add (GTK_CONTAINER (scrolled_window), list->priv->view);

  return object;
}

/*#
    @class GtkCellRendererAccel
    @brief Renders a keyboard accelerator in a cell

    GtkCellRendererAccel displays a keyboard accelerator (i.e. a key combination
    like <Control>-a). If the cell renderer is editable, the accelerator can be
    changed by simply typing the new combination.
 */
FALCON_FUNC CellRendererAccel::init( VMARG )
{
    NO_ARGS
    MYSELF;
    self->setObject( (GObject*) gtk_cell_renderer_accel_new() );
}
